Job Description
HDM Solar is a rapidly growing wholesale company in the renewable energy sector and we require a business development manager to continue to support the growth of our sales. Reporting into the sales and marketing director, this role will suit an experienced, ambitious and energetic BDM looking for a dynamic company on an upwards trajectory. You will be the front of the company and will have the dedication to create and apply an effective sales strategy. Your responsibilities will include the development of a business strategy focused on financial gain, arranging business development meetings with prospective clients and expanding our clientele. Ambitious for the future as the company develops through a period of rapid growth, you want to be part of that success utilising your skills and experience to drive sustainable financial growth through boosting sales and forging strong relationships with clients. You are a clear communicator and have great inter-personal skills. No two days will be the same, so you will need to be adaptable and positive in your approach to tasks.

Key Responsibilities
- Develop a growth strategy focused both on financial gain and customer satisfaction
- Conduct research to identify new markets and customer needs
- Arrange business meetings with prospective clients
- Promote the company's products/services addressing or predicting clients' objectives
- Prepare sales orders ensuring adherence to law-established rules and guidelines
- Provide trustworthy feedback and aftersales support
- Build long-term relationships with new and existing customers
- Develop entry-level staff into valuable salespeople
Requirements & Skills
- Proven working experience as a business development manager, sales executive or a relevant role
- Proven sales track record
- Experience in customer support is a plus
- Proficiency in MS Office and CRM software (eg Zoho)
- Proficiency in English
- Market knowledge
- Communication and negotiation skills
- Ability to build rapport
- Time management and planning skills
- BSc/BA in business administration, sales or relevant field (not essential)
